Episode 76
“How cringeworthy.”
Yelshanad was her usual cold-blooded self today.
Milligan failed to grab her hand and followed behind with quick steps.
“Where are you going, my lady!”
And he froze stiff when he saw about ten people huddled together in a secluded garden with a single tree.
“What’s happening here?”
“A family picnic with Airi.”
Though her tone was indifferent, he knew.
This was Yelshanad showing her warm side like a spring breeze!
But if she was showing this side to Airi, he could accept it.
“Ah, I wondered what you were up to. Let’s go together, my lady!”
What he faced after eagerly following Yelshanad was Airi sitting on a picnic mat.
“Master! No, Grandfather, you came!”
“Yes, have you been well?”
“Yes! We’re having a family picnic today! I’m so happy you came too, Grandfather!”
“My, what an adorable little round thing.”
Yelshanad enviously watched Milligan openly express his affection.
Instead, she watched Airi diligently spreading the picnic mat and clenched and unclenched her fists.
‘They say seeing something too cute enhances violent tendencies.’
Right now, her emotions were turning violent.
“Oh! And since friends are family too, I brought lots and lots of them!”
To a former second-grade elementary student, peers were like family.
The hybrid creature friends including Karhen huddled together on the picnic mat.
Serafin also sat on the mat while grumbling heavily.
Declan came from afar and sat near the tree trunk.
“Why.”
“It would be nice if Elder came closer too…”
Airi made a slightly disappointed sound.
Then Serafin said maturely.
“Anyway, we’re all sitting together, so I’m fine!”
A lie. The hurt was showing around his eyes.
He couldn’t give false assurance that someday they’d be able to sit close together for a happy picnic.
Instead, Declan chuckled and said.
“Still, in the portrait for your vacation homework, everyone is close together.”
Then Serafin’s eyes sparkled.
“Yes! In the portrait, we’re even holding hands!”
Watching Serafin perk up, he smiled softly.
‘That’s a relief.’
But the elderly couple seemed curious about their conversation.
“Huh? What’s this talk about a portrait?”
“Father doesn’t need to know.”
“Tsk, ungrateful child.”
Milligan clicked his tongue as if all his affection had dried up.
Then he looked at Airi and smiled brightly.
Watching the standoff between Declan and Milligan, Airi quickly extended her hand.
There was something she really wanted to do if she got to have a ‘family picnic.’
“Th-then, this is my first family picnic, but…”
“Hm?”
“Since we’re at a picnic, I’ll show you an interesting dance!”
A talent show!
Airi wiggled her bottom and waved both arms.
Her expression was quite serious, which made her seem even more adorable.
Seeing her somewhat comically cute appearance, it felt like all the tension from guarding the front lines was melting away.
Milligan, Yelshanad, Declan, Serafin, and Karhen with the other friends too.
Everyone kept their eyes fixed on Airi.
The northern sky wasn’t clear and remained gloomy as always.
But still, with everyone gathered together, it felt like standing under sunlight.
After finishing her dance, Airi bowed politely.
Applause started by Declan spread to everyone.
Amid the pouring applause, Airi felt like she had received this entire day as a gift.
“Picnics are really, really exciting!”
So Airi asked her friends loudly.
“Karhen, Belize, Saal, Lireed, Dinan! How do you all like the picnic?”
“It’s fun.”
They weren’t just saying it was fun with words – they too seemed to be enjoying this peaceful day.
It felt like happiness was pouring in.
So Airi unconsciously lay down on the picnic mat.
“My heart keeps pounding!”
Meanwhile, Cookie in her pocket.
[What, this is pretty boring. Isn’t there anyone I can absorb magi from~?]
Grumbled like that.
But Airi was very happy with the peaceful picnic in the garden.
‘So this is what family picnics are like. Now I know too!’
Back when she was ‘Airin.’
When friends said ‘I went on a picnic to Han River with mom but it wasn’t that fun,’ she could only envy them.
‘Now I can say I’ve been on a picnic too and it was fun!’
She felt a fulfillment she couldn’t experience in her previous life filling one corner of her heart.
But there was just one thing she missed.
‘Melissa Marquess Grandmother isn’t beside me.’
…I miss her.
Was it because of her longing?
The clouds drifting through the dark northern sky looked just like Grandmother’s face.
* * *
Meanwhile, in the Southern Region, Melissa Marquess was waiting for important news.
Melissa Marquess was finally able to receive ‘that thing’ she had been eagerly awaiting.
It meant she could now see the face of Airi whom she missed so much.
